Let's dive into these roles and examine their job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demands: 1. **Psychologist**: As a psychologist, you'll study the human mind and behavior. According to the latest job market trends, this role is in high demand across various industries, with an average salary range of £30,000 to £80,000 per year. Key skills include communication, problem-solving, and a deep understanding of psychology principles. 2. **Career Counselor**: A career counselor helps individuals make informed decisions about their education, career, and employment options. Job market trends show a steady demand for career counselors in the UK, with an average salary range of £25,000 to £50,000 per year. Crucial skills for this role include active listening, empathy, and knowledge of labor market information and resources. 3. **Talent Acquisition Specialist**: Talent acquisition specialists focus on finding and hiring top talent for their organizations. With the rise of remote work and digital recruitment, this role has experienced significant growth in recent years. The average salary range for talent acquisition specialists in the UK is £25,000 to £60,000 per year. Key skills include networking, negotiation, and candidate assessment. 4. **HR Manager**: An HR manager is responsible for managing an organization's workforce, overseeing employee relations, and implementing HR policies. This role is vital to any business, and job market trends reflect a consistent demand for HR managers. The average salary range for HR managers in the UK is £30,000 to £70,000 per year. Essential skills for HR managers include communication, organization, and strategic thinking.
